The Final Destination film series is making a strong return after 14 years, and fans of horror and suspense are excited. Known for its chilling plots and thrilling sequences, this franchise has already delivered five successful parts. Now, the makers are back with the sixth installment titled “Final Destination: Bloodlines”.
Releasing Soon in Theatres
The official trailer of Final Destination: Bloodlines has already been released. The film is set to hit theatres on May 16, 2025. What’s in the Trailer?
The 1-minute and 9-second trailer shows how death finds people in unexpected ways. In one intense scene, a glass breaks and a piece of it falls into ice. That same ice is used in another drink — and viewers are left wondering, “Who will drink it? What will happen next?”
